Enlarged Tonsil and lymph node (UTE)

Hello Everyone, 

At the start of the year around March time I was feeling really unwell and feverish. I went to the doctors for them to say I had tonsilitis and was given antibiotics. 6 weeks later and 3 more lots of antibiotics I had never fully felt like my energetic, proactive self again. I had started to notice my right tonsil has not gone down and a little bit of sweeling in my neck. So with this I went to urgent care mainly for a different opinion and they once again said it was just a viral infection and it will pass. 

At this point I just moved on even though I never felt 100% myself. 7 months later, my tonsil had gotten slightly larger and the neck node had felt more harder but not a lot bigger, with a persistent sore throat and the feeling of something in my mouth almost like hair that wasn't there (Not seen anyone talk about this before.) so I went back to the GP, the doctor had one look and she referred me for 2ww ENT. I seen the ENT on 11th November and he explained that the tonsil and nodes are enlarged but do not look alarming after examination. 

I was given an option of Tonsillectomy and MRI or just MRI and see where we are at that stage. I told the doctor I would go with his recommendation of Tonsillectomy and MRI. I have already had a call for an MRI on Saturday 18th which surprised me (SO QUICK).

  • I had the same thing I had white spots and englarged tonsils for 4 months straight would go to gp who would prescribe me antibiotics which would work initially but week later or so would come back I was refered to ent under cancer pathway and saw a consultant who told me that the antibiotic they were givin me more or less was the same strength so he presided me stronger anti biotics and steriod tablets aswell like yours one side was more enlarged than the other and he sent me for mri. Anyways tablets worked mri came clean and it’s been 5months and Iv Been clear from it. Turned out I had strep throat that wasn’t treated properly. Consultant didn’t know this as my Swab test came back after my initial consultation. Also while I was down this route I did read about getting tonsils removed and most was saying it’s more painful as an adult longer recovery.
